ISO/IEC 9126 Software engineering — Product quality was an international standard for the evaluation of software quality.It has been replaced by ISO/IEC 25010:2011. [1]The quality criteria according to ISO 9126
Software quality assurance (SQA) is a means and practice of monitoring all software engineering processes, methods, and work products to ensure compliance against defined standards. [1] It may include ensuring conformance to standards or models, such as ISO/IEC 9126 (now superseded by ISO 25010), SPICE or CMMI .

DO-178B, Software Considerations in Airborne Systems and Equipment Certification is a guideline dealing with the safety of safety-critical software used in certain airborne systems. Chapter 6.1 defines the purpose for the software verification process. DO-178C adds the following statement about the Executable Object Code: "The Executable Object Code satisfies the software requirements (that is, intended function), and provides confidence in the absence of unintended functionality."

The Project Management Institute's PMBOK Guide "Software Extension" defines not "Software quality" itself, but Software Quality Assurance (SQA) as "a continuous process that audits other software processes to ensure that those processes are being followed (includes for example a software quality management plan)."
